In recent months, a vibrant hue has quietly reshaped visual conversations across social feeds, design portfolios, and retail displays: magenta color. Once a niche choice, it now commands attention in fashion, tech, wellness, and branding—marking a noticeable shift in aesthetic preferences. What explains this surge, and why does magenta color now dominate digital discovery?
Academic and design circles note that magenta color—a vivid blend of red and blue light—stands out due to its rarity in natural color palettes. Its bold presence disrupts the dominance of neutral tones and pastels, offering a psychological punch that captures focus without overwhelming. This visual contrast makes it a powerful tool for emotion-driven communication, particularly among younger, design-savvy audiences receiving high volumes of digital stimuli daily.

How magenta color Actually Works
Magenta is a synthetic, non-spectral color—created by mixing red and blue wavelengths, but not found in nature without human intervention. In digital design, it occupies equal space on the color wheel opposite purple, balancing warmth and coolness. When applied in user interfaces or branding, magenta color can evoke energy, confidence, and creativity without the intensity of traditional reds. Its versatility allows it to complement a wide range of palettes, making it effective across industries from app development to fashion.
While saturations and contrasts moderate its intensity, properly balanced magenta color engages attention subtly. Studies in visual psychology suggest that this hue stimulates curiosity and memory retention, particularly in saturated quality. When used thoughtfully—avoiding overuse—it enhances readability, brand recall, and emotional connection.

Common Questions About Magenta Color
How is magenta color produced?
Magenta is a synthetic color created by combining red and blue light in digital environments or derived from pigment mixing in physical production. In printers, it results from equal parts cyan and magenta ink under subtractive color models.
Can magenta color be used in professional settings?
Yes. In design, technology, and marketing, magenta adds personality and visual hierarchy. Its rarity and boldness make it ideal for calls to action, accents, or layout focal points—when balanced with neutral tones.
Why aren’t I seeing more of magenta color in everyday life?
Despite its appeal, true magenta rarely appears in nature. Its vibrant saturation demands deliberate engineering, limiting widespread organic use. However, digital platforms now normalize it through consistent rendering and branding campaigns.
Is magenta color universal or culturally sensitive?
While widely accepted globally, perception varies subtly by cultural context. In the US, it’s embraced for confidence and creativity but remains neutral in personal or symbolic associations, making it safe for broad application.

Opportunities and Considerations
Pros:
- High visual contrast boosts attention and memorability
- Evokes positive emotions—creativity, energy, warmth—without overstimulation
- Versatile across digital and physical branding
- Supports inclusive identity expression in design
Cons:
- Risk of overuse leading to visual fatigue
- Must be paired thoughtfully to maintain balance
- Some may find it too intense for minimalist or calming contexts
Audiences expect authenticity; magenta color works best when integrated with credible intent and design strategy. Avoid treating it as a quick aesthetic fix—its impact emerges from purposeful application.
Misunderstandings About Magenta Color
Myth: Magenta color is only for bold or youthful audiences.
Reality: Brands use magenta across demographics to signal innovation, warmth, and confidence. It suits mature audiences when applied with nuance.
Myth: Magenta is a random or unstable hue.
Reality: True magenta, when calibrated, delivers consistent, stable color across digital and print mediums.
Myth: Using magenta guarantees success in marketing.
Reality: Like any design tool, its effectiveness depends on context, audience, and execution.
